About Duplin Country Club
Duplin Country Club is a par 72, 18-hole championship golf course that spans 6,319 yards. While the course is on the shorter side, it presents a challenge even for experienced golfers. The greens, made of Champion Bermuda, are small and fast, adding to the difficulty. Towering pines and natural wetland areas enhance the beautiful scenery, making it a delightful place to play. The club is also a popular venue for weddings in eastern North Carolina, providing a lovely setting and a friendly staff dedicated to making special days memorable.
